    Current Research and Scholarly InterestsThe Ó Maoiléidigh group employs mathematical and computational approaches to better understand normal hearing and hearing impairment. Because complete restoration of auditory function by artificial devices or regenerative treatments will only be possible when experiments and computational modeling align, we work closely with experimental laboratories. Our goal is to understand contemporary experimental observations, to make experimentally testable predictions, and to motivate new experiments. We are pursuing several projects.

    Hair-Bundle Mechanics

    Auditory and balance organs rely on hair cells to convert mechanical vibrations into electrical signals for transmission to the brain. In response to the quietest sounds we can hear, the hair cell's mechanical sensor, the hair bundle, moves by less than one-billionth of a meter. To determine how this astounding sensitivity is possible, we construct computational models of hair-bundle mechanics. By comparing models with experimental observations, we are learning how a hair bundle's geometry, material properties, and ability to move spontaneously determine its function.

    Cochlear Mechanics

    The cochlea contains the auditory organ that houses the sensory hair cells in mammals. Vibrations in the cochlea arising from sound are amplified more than a thousandfold by the ear's active process. New experimental techniques have additionally revealed that the cochlea vibrates in a complex manner in response to sound. We use computational models to interpret these observations and to make hypotheses about how the cochlea works.

    Current Research and Scholarly InterestsMany adult organs tune their functional capacity to variable levels of physiologic demand. Adaptive organ resizing breaks the allometry of the body plan that was established during development, suggesting that it occurs through different mechanisms. Emerging evidence points to stem cells as key players in these mechanisms. We use the Drosophila midgut, a stem-cell based organ analogous to the vertebrate small intestine, as a simple model to uncover the rules that govern adaptive remodeling.

    BioAnne Joseph O’Connell is a lawyer and social scientist whose research and teaching focuses on administrative law and the federal bureaucracy. Outside of Stanford, she is a contributor to the Center on Regulation and Markets at the Brookings Institution and an appointed senior fellow of the Administrative Conference of the United States, an independent federal agency dedicated to improving regulatory procedures. She is an elected fellow of the American Academy of Arts and Sciences and the National Academy of Public Administration, and an elected member of the American Law Institute.

    O’Connell has written on a number of topics, including agency rulemaking, the selection of agency leaders, and bureaucratic organization (and reorganization). Her publications have appeared in leading law and political science journals. She has co-edited a book (with Daniel A. Farber), Research Handbook on Public Choice and Public Law, and she joined the Gellhorn and Byse’s Administrative Law casebook as a co-editor with the twelfth edition.

    O’Connell’s research has received a number of awards. She is a two-time recipient of the ABA’s Scholarship Award in Administrative Law for the best article or book published in the preceding year — for her 2014 article “Bureaucracy at the Boundary” and her 2009 article “Vacant Offices: Delays in Staffing Top Agency Positions.” She is also a two-time winner of the Richard D. Cudahy Writing Competition on Regulatory and Administrative Law from the American Constitution Society—for her article “Actings” (co-winner in 2020) and for her co-authored article (with Farber) “The Lost World of Administrative Law” (2014). Her article “Political Cycles of Rulemaking” was the top paper selected for the Association of American Law Schools’ 2007-2008 Scholarly Papers Competition for untenured faculty members. In addition, her research has been cited by Congress, the Supreme Court, the D.C. Circuit, and the Ninth Circuit, and has been featured in the Washington Post and other national media.

    At Stanford Law School, O’Connell teaches administrative law, advanced administrative law, and constitutional law. The class of 2020 chose her to receive the Hurlbut Award, which is given to one professor “who strives to make teaching an art.” She currently co-chairs the school’s efforts to improve teaching and classroom climate and serves on the steering committee for Stanford University’s Faculty Women’s Forum. Prior to joining Stanford University in 2018, O’Connell was the George Johnson Professor of Law at the University of California, Berkeley. While there, she received the Distinguished Teaching Award (the campus’s most prestigious honor for teaching) in 2016 and Berkeley Law’s Rutter Award for Teaching Distinction in 2012. From April 2013 to July 2015, she served as associate dean for faculty development and research, under three different deans. In 2013-2014, O’Connell was co-president of the Society for Empirical Legal Studies (co-organizing the 2014 Conference on Empirical Legal Studies).

    Before joining the Berkeley Law faculty in 2004, O’Connell clerked for Justice Ruth Bader Ginsburg during the Supreme Court’s October 2003 term. From 2001 to 2003, she was a trial attorney for the Department of Justice’s Federal Programs Branch where she received special commendation for her work. She clerked for Judge Stephen F. Williams of the U.S. Court of Appeals for the D.C. Circuit from 2000 to 2001. A Truman Scholar, O’Connell worked for a number of federal agencies in earlier years, including the Department of Defense (General Counsel and Inspector General), Federal Trade Commission (Bureau of Competition), Department of Justice (Office of Legal Counsel), and U.S. Army (RDE). She is a member of the New York bar and served as a volunteer for the Biden-Harris Campaign’s policy team.

    Current Research and Scholarly InterestsThe O'Connell lab studies how genetic and environmental factors contribute to biological diversity and adaptation. We are particularly interested in understanding (1) how behavior evolves through changes in brain function and (2) how animal physiology evolves through repurposing existing cellular components.

    Current Research and Scholarly InterestsDr. O'Hara's research aims to investigate how cognitive information processing deficits subserve affective symptoms in psychiatric disorders, and interact with key brain networks integral to these disorders. To do so, she has implemented a translational, interdisciplinary program that encompasses cellular models, brain and behavioral assays of affective and cognitive information processing systems in psychiatric disorders across the lifespan.

    Current Research and Scholarly InterestsPolitical economy and the process of reform in transitional systems, with particular focus on corporate restructuring and fiscal politics. Oi’s new project empirically assess the impact of China’s Belt and Road Initiative (BRI) by taking an institutional and micro-level approach to identify the key players and their interests. Is the BRI is a tightly coordinated central state effort, as some assert, or another example of local state development taking advantage of global opportunities?
